Dr. Daniel R. Pieper is a board certified neurosurgeon, internationally recognized for his expertise in the treatment of cerebrovascular, skull base and craniofacial surgery.

He is one of the leading authorities in the treatment of tumors affecting hearing.  His pioneering work in the techniques of minimally invasive skull base surgery have led to improved outcomes in the treatment of pituitary tumors, trigeminal neuralgia and hemifacial spasm for which he was honored recently at the World Congress of Endoscopic Surgery of the Brain, Skull Base and Spine. He was recently named as one of the top surgeons in the U.S. as ranked by his peers.
